How the catalogue began — and why it remained independent.
Brussels, early 2021. The specialist — at the time maintaining a private nutrition practice focused on active men between 30 and 55 — began keeping a personal log of the supplement formulations his clients were encountering in the Belgian wellness market. The log was a cross-reference: ingredient source, serving schedule, third-party documentation status. Not a recommendation, but a record.
Over eighteen months, the log grew to cover 47 formulation entries. A pattern emerged: the same active-lifestyle supplements appeared repeatedly across different client profiles, but with sharply inconsistent ingredient transparency. Some carried certificates of composition. Many did not. Several listed botanical ingredients by common name only, without regional or varietal specification.
The decision to publish the log as the Otaliven catalogue followed a straightforward observation: no independent, non-retail index of men's daily supplement formulations existed in English for the Belgian and wider European active-lifestyle market. Otaliven filled that absence.

Documentation as a discipline.
Otaliven operates on a principle borrowed from archival practice: record what exists, not what should exist. The catalogue does not evaluate formulations against an ideal. It describes what a given composition contains, where those ingredients originate, and how the serving schedule is structured.
This approach means the catalogue covers formulations across a range of quality tiers. The documentation of a batch-verified, whole-food sourced formulation and the documentation of a less transparent one are both useful to a reader navigating the supplement market — the contrast itself is informative.
